What Causes Seizures?

My two year old grandaughter has breath holding syndrome ... she has siezures occasionally ... now my daughter is telling me that she is having a bad taste in her mouth when she eats or drinks somthing she will spit it out and say yuk .... also she lifts her shirt up and says ouch ... but there is nothing there ... are these symtoms?? or could somthing else be wrong?

Pediatrician 's  Response
Hi, breath holding spells tend to decrease as child grow older. The symptoms which you have narrated are not related to seizures, it can be a habitual thing. I think you should not worry about this and encourage your child to eat more and stay healthy.
